The Graco LiteRider Classic Connect Stroller in Dragonfly is a versatile and stylish stroller designed for modern parents. It features a secure one-step attachment for Graco Click Connect infant car seats, a comfortable reclining seat, and a convenient one-hand fold, making it the perfect companion for your family outings.

Fabulous carriage for the price!
My daughter needed a lightweight stroller that folded easily, had a large storage basket, and a cup holder for her ice coffee etc. This Graco stroller fit the bill. It folds flat, unlike an umbrella stroller, but this is NOT an umbrella stroller, so if your looking for that, this carriage is not for you. It takes more room in the trunk of the car because of that. If you are a tall person, 5’10” or above, you will absolutely love the height of the handle; it will not hurt your back while pushing like most others. Also, the spacious basket underneath folds downwards in the front via a hinge to make it easy to put larger packages in it- a great, useful design. My daughter easily opens and closes this carriage with one hand. She and her husband, both very tall, love this carriage and have no complaints about it. Do not hesitate to purchase this amazingly well-priced carriage especially if you have a roomy trunk. Remember, it folds flat. I'd purchase this Graco carriage again in a heartbeat.

The first is that the instructions suck big time
I have a Graco Classic Connect SnugRider infant car seat and wanted a stroller that I could insert the car seat into. I have a Baby Jogger but to my dismay that's the one model that does not support a car seat adapter. I chose this because it's made for the Classic Connect car seats, and I figured it would be less problematic overall. The unit arrived in a couple of days, and I was able to put it together without too much difficulty except for a couple of things. I'm giving this four stars instead of five because of these two issues. The first is that the instructions suck big time. You might as well figure it out yourself mostly. The second thing is when the wheels go on, there is a black cover on the rail. For the life of me, I could not get the wheel assembly pushed in hard enough for it to click on tightly. Finally I just pulled the black sleeves off and then I was able to hook in the wheel assembly without any problems. The black sleeves seem to serve no real purpose other than cosmetic, so I figured no big deal. Then I placed the car seat on it and again, the instructions suck, so you kind of have to figure it out on your own, but how difficult can it be? Not too bad I suppose. The unit itself seems sturdy and light all at the same time, which feels contradictory, but it is both sturdy and the wheels are awesome on smooth ground. I don't plan to use this while jogging etc. I'll be using it mostly from the parking lot to inside stores etc. All in all, I recommend this if you have a Classic Connect car seat.

Fantastic traveling stroller!
I.love.this.stroller! I am slightly handicapped so I have a hard time pushing and puting away the larger strollers when I am by myself. This one is SO easy to fold and is ridiculously light weight. The basket underneath is bigger than any you would get on a normal light weight umbrella stroller. We went to Aquatica and I was able to fit our beach bag and a small shoulder cooler under there with no problem AND we were still able to lay the seat back for my son to nap. Unfortunately, it does go all the way down, but because it has the side headrest cushions my son slept comfortably. There is also a large cup/cell phone holder up by the handle. You can fit two large drinks and both smartphones with no problem. If I had to pick one thing I did not like about this stroller it would be the child's tray. Its great when the child needs to use it, but it does not come off quite as easy. In my other Graco stroller the tray had swivels on each side so you could lift it up on either side to get the child out easier. Like I said, I am slightly handicapped so that feature came in handy. This one I have to try really hard to pop it off or I have to lift him out. It's not the end of the world and it doesnt make me love this stroller any less!I am excited to see how well this stroller holds up during our trip to NY since we will have to take it on the plane with us.
